Gaby Kerpel

Carnabailito

2003-10-14

Carnabailito is the solo debut from Gaby Kerpel, a composer and musician for the theatrical group, De La Guarda. The disc is produced by Gustavo Santaolalla, an active participant in the Latin music scene since the 60's. The sound is based on traditional Argentinean folk music with Spanish lyrics that speak mostly of unrequited love, presented upon stuttering rhythms that have an African feel. Lots of electronica here as well with the use of looping and sampling. An array of musical instruments are to be heard, like an Argentinean charango, the kalimba, the Brazilian carquinho, an erhu (a chinese violin) as well as flute and accordian. The creative use of sound is the highlight of this disc, making it a fun listen!
